The garage my car lives at only works on evo's and has several race spec 800+ bhp evo they have built, most of their customers are arround the 500 mark. There are better ways to get 400bhp where the power is a lot more usable. admitadly Im talking more experience of the VIII FQ400 than the X but Im guessing its going to be similar. I would still rather buy a standard one and give the extra £20k to a tuner like www.nr-autosport.com you will have a lot better car.

Read this article from the MLR in the UK who tested one against an FQ340

In in it states....
The low rpm acceleration tests were chosen to test acceleration from just 2500rpm. The FQ-340’s turbo response helped it start accelerating hard almost immediately even in the higher gears and it pulled strongly all the way to the red line in every gear we tested. It was a very different story with the FQ-400, as the lag from the FQ-400’s turbo meant that for every in-gear acceleration test the FQ-340 out accelerated the FQ-400 for almost 2/3rds of the acceleration run. It was only in the last third of each run that FQ-400 out accelerated the FQ-340.
